Is there a bug in Captivate 9 that won't recognize mouse click for title text? Mac issue

I just installed Captivate 9 on my Mac, and it won't recognize the mouse double click to enter text into a title box.  Caption text works, but Title text doesn't.  I am working in the responsive mode.

    Hi rayhoskins,

    We haven't come across such an issue. Can you please clear captivate preferences and try once. .

    Captivate Preferences can be cleared by double clicking on the following file: Applications\Adobe Captivaate 9\utils\ClearPreferencesMac

    If you still face the issue please provide the Machine config?
